Your role: Quality Control Technician, Microbiology
As an Quality Control Technician, Microbiology, you will be an important member of the Quality Control team, supporting microbiology testing, environmental and utility monitoring, sample management, and laboratory operations. In this role, you will help ensure accurate, compliant testing and documentation while supporting sterile manufacturing operations in a cGMP environment.
Your Responsibilities:
Perform routine and non-routine environmental monitoring, including viable/non-viable air, surface, personnel, and manufacturing area sampling.
Monitor and test critical utilities, including WFI, USP Water, Pure Steam, and Clean Compressed Air.
Conduct microbiology testing of raw materials, in-process materials, finished products, and stability samples, including endotoxin, bioburden, mycoplasma, and sterility testing.
Perform microbiology support activities including media growth promotion, gram staining, microbial identification, and other laboratory testing.
Provide production support through production fills and aseptic process simulations while maintaining sterile gowning qualifications.
Support quality investigations and documentation, including OOS/OOT investigations, environmental and facility investigations, deviations, Certificates of Analysis, SOPs, and controlled documents.
Assist with method development, validation, qualification, method transfers, and analytical studies, as well as equipment validation, calibration, and maintenance.
Maintain laboratory operations, inventory, equipment checks, cleanliness, and accurate data while ensuring compliance with cGMP, safety, environmental, and regulatory requirements.
